


From Stornoway take the A859 to Liurbost,
Turn right onto the A858;
From Tarbert take the A589 signposted for Stornoway; at Liurbost (approximately 30 miles) turn left onto the A858. If you come to the garage on your left and the school on your right - STOP! You have missed the junction - time for a quick 'u' turn!
You are now heading towards the best part of Lewis - I know we are biased but it is true!
At Gearraidh nah Aibhne,take the left turn signposted ’Uig’.
Follow the road for approximately 17 miles, until you reach the sign for Cradhlastadh at the top of the steep and rocky Glen Valtos.
Turn right, head up the hill, keep bearing to the right, past the new buisiness units (doesn't sound romantic, but done in the best possible taste!) and turn next left here. OK, I don't see my first exhibition of photographs featuring 'Great Left Turns in Lewis' but at least you will know where to go!
The sign usefully says 'Cradhlastadh' and Mrs Wade has added her own liitle touch by decorating a metal buoy found on the shore with the helpful inscription 'B and B'!!
TURN LEFT HERE!

Follow the road for a mile and a half (3km) and when you see the postbox
TURN RGHT HERE!

We are at the end of the lane, in about 200m.
Look for the white double fronted bungalow - don't forget, if you get this wrong, next stop is New England, USA!
